Western countries recognized Russian fleet by a threat to NATO

The Russian Navy is increasing its strength and becomes a threat to NATO, writes Business Insider.

So, in the material of the publication it is said that the fleet inherited by Russia from the Soviet Union quickly fell into decay after the Cold War. However, over the past 20 years, Moscow has invested significant funds in their navy. “The result is the growing modern forces that create unique problems for the NATO armed forces,” the publication recognized.

Speakers of Western countries explained that now Russia makes a bet on new small ships with rockets and nuclear submarines, equipping them with high-precision manageable ammunitions of a large range.
